建议从诺基亚论坛上下载安装"Nokia Connectivity Framework"。我不知道它是否支持在真机和仿真器之间互发短信,但我用它在两个仿真器之间互发过短信,下面简要说一下当时的配置过程。
1. 安装SDK
安装S60 SDK 2.2和S60 SDK 2.3
安装"Nokia Connectivity Framework 1.2"
2. 配置环境
打开"Nokia Connectivity Framework",将左侧窗口中的"Projects"->"Terminal SDKs"->"Series 60 2nd Ed. SDK for Symbian OS FP2 ...",和"Projects"->"Terminal SDKs"->"Series 60 2nd Ed. SDK for Symbian OS FP3 ..."拖到右侧的窗口中,此时右侧窗口中出现两个仿真器的图标,图标下侧列出了该仿真器的蓝牙地址和MMS/SMS号码。
然后用鼠标从其中一个图标向另一个图标引一条连线。
3. 启动环境
分别在两个仿真器图标上单击右键,然后从弹出式菜单中选择"Start Product"启动仿真器。
4. 发送短消息
进入某个仿真器的"Messages"应用程序,编写一条短信,其中"to:"域填写另一个仿真器的SMS号码,然后发送该短信。首次发送时会弹出对话框要求设置服务中心的号码,随便填个数(我填的1),点OK就行了。
5. 接收短消息
打开另一个仿真器的"Messages"应用程序,就能看到"Inbox"收到了刚才发的短信。